New Delhi: The Congress on Tuesday said that Jammu "becoming the center of terror incidents" reflected the "strategic failure" of the Modi government and demanded that the Center should give confidence to the country about the measures it was taking to deal with the situation.

The opposition party also called for a befitting response from Pakistan in the wake of increasing terrorist incidents in Jammu and Kashmir.

The Congress statement came a day after five army personnel, including a junior officer, were killed and several others injured when heavily armed terrorists ambushed a patrolling party in the remote Machedi area of ​​J&K's Kathua district. .

Addressing a press conference at AICC headquarters here, Congress leader Deepender Hooda said this attack is highly condemnable.

He said the government should give a suo motu statement on the measures it is taking in the wake of the recent terror attacks in the state.

"Even before this, in December 2023, four of our soldiers were martyred in Rajouri. There was an encounter in Kulgam, in which two of our soldiers were martyred.

"There was a terror attack in Doda on June 26. A terror attack was also carried out on a bus on June 9," Hooda said, listing the recent terror attacks in J&K.

Leader of the Opposition in Lok Sabha Rahul Gandhi has asserted that the solution to persistent terror attacks must be strict action, not empty promises, Hooda said.

"Figures show that the number of civilians and security forces personnel killed in terror incidents in the Jammu region has doubled since January 2023," he said.

The center of terror incidents has now shifted from the Kashmir Valley to Jammu and this "reflects the strategic failure" of the Modi government, he said.

The Modi government is not taking the land situation in Jammu and Kashmir seriously and is instead more busy presenting its narrative to the country, he claimed.

"Every time the Modi government introduces any plan, it links it with terrorism and says that terrorism will be eradicated. When demonetisation happened in the country and Article 370 was removed in Jammu and Kashmir, even then there was talk of elimination of terrorism. But now the government should reflect on the situation that has arisen," he said.

Pakistan has come to the brink of becoming a "failed state" and yet it dares to do so, Hooda said, adding that now is the time to give a befitting response to Pakistan.

"As a responsible opposition, we are with the Government for the security of the country," he stated.
